

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Résolution des problèmes liés à Amazon CodeCatalyst et à VS Code
<a name="codecatalyst-troubleshoot"></a>

Les rubriques suivantes traitent des problèmes techniques potentiels liés à l'utilisation d'Amazon CodeCatalyst et de VS Code.

**Topics**
+ [Version du code VS](#codecatalyst-troubleshoot-vsc)
+ [Autorisations pour Amazon CodeCatalyst](#codecatalyst-troubleshoot-permission)
+ [Connexion à un environnement de développement depuis le Toolkit for VS Code](#codecatalyst-troubleshoot-connecting)

## Version du code VS
<a name="codecatalyst-troubleshoot-vsc"></a>

Votre version de VS Code devrait configurer un gestionnaire pour `vscode://` URIs votre système. Sans ce gestionnaire, vous ne pouvez pas accéder à toutes les CodeCatalyst fonctionnalités du AWS Toolkit. Par exemple, vous rencontrez une erreur lors du lancement d'un environnement de développement à partir de VS Code Insiders. C'est parce que VS Code Insiders gère `vscode-insiders://` URIs et ne gère pas. `vscode://` URIs

## Autorisations pour Amazon CodeCatalyst
<a name="codecatalyst-troubleshoot-permission"></a>

Les autorisations de fichier requises pour travailler avec les fichiers sont CodeCatalyst les AWS Toolkit for Visual Studio Code suivantes :
+ Définissez vos propres autorisations d'accès pour votre `~/.ssh/config` fichier à `read` et`write`. Limitez `write` les autorisations pour tous les autres utilisateurs.
+ Définissez vos autorisations d'accès pour les `~/.ssh/id_rsa` fichiers `~/.ssh/id_dsa ` et `read` uniquement sur. `read`Restriction `write` et `execute` autorisations pour tous les autres utilisateurs.
+ Votre `globals.context.globalStorageUri.fsPath` fichier doit se trouver dans un emplacement accessible en écriture.

## Connexion à un environnement de développement depuis le Toolkit for VS Code
<a name="codecatalyst-troubleshoot-connecting"></a>

Si le message d'erreur suivant s'affiche lorsque vous tentez de vous connecter à un environnement de développement à partir du AWS Toolkit for Visual Studio Code :

*Vous `~/.ssh/config` avez une `aws-devenv-*` section qui n'est peut-être plus à jour.*
+ Choisissez la **configuration ouverte.** bouton pour ouvrir votre `~/.ssh/config` fichier dans l'**éditeur** de code VS.
+ Dans l'**éditeur**, sélectionnez et supprimez le contenu de la `Host aws-devenv-*` section.
+ Enregistrez les modifications que vous avez apportées `Host aws-devenv-*` au`~/.ssh/config`. Fermez ensuite le fichier.
+ Réessayez de vous connecter à un environnement de développement à partir du Toolkit for VS Code.